I would avoid this paper. It had issues with flaking, and for some reason Hahnemuehle was never able to solve issues with the coating being incredibly fragile in the bond to the substrate. I've never seen a fine art paper that you were not able to trim to a full bleed, if desired. Using a brand new mat knife blade, it still chipped excessively and showed white substrate all along the surface of the print with uneven chips missing. After trimming, it left behind powdered ink and coating underneath the cut. They even publicly send an email to purchasers telling them that it did not meet their standards (of course, no offer of compensation for the problems). Nice paper, otherwise, but not worth the effort.
